How much do temporary sentara nurse practitioner j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 1, 2026, the average yearly pay for temporary sentara nurse practitioner in the United States is $130,295.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$108,000.00 and $150,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Temporary Sentara Nurse Practitioner vs Permanent Sentara Nurse Practitioner?

AspectTemporary Sentara Nurse PractitionerPermanent Sentara Nurse Practitioner
CredentialsRegistered Nurse (RN) license, Nurse Practitioner (NP) certification, possibly temporary or agency-specific credentialsRN license, NP certification, state licensure, and possibly hospital privileges
Work EnvironmentShort-term assignments, flexible scheduling, often in various departments or locationsFull-time employment, consistent work setting within Sentara facilities
Employer & Industry UsageStaffing agencies, healthcare staffing firms, Sentara's temporary staffing programsSentara Healthcare, hospital or clinic employment

The main difference is that Temporary Sentara Nurse Practitioners work on short-term assignments through staffing agencies, offering flexibility and varied experiences. Permanent Sentara Nurse Practitioners are employed full-time within Sentara facilities, providing continuity of care and consistent employment benefits.

Job description

Join a thriving Internal Medicine residency practice where collaboration, mentorship, and exceptional patient care come together. Sentara Medical Group - Internal Medicine Residency Clinic– Prince William, is seeking an experienced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ant to become an integral part of a warm, collegial outpatient team serving an adult patient population. This 100% outpatient role offers a flexible weekday schedule with no call, no weekends, and the opportunity to work alongside an experienced physician in a supportive residency clinic environment. Providers enjoy the rewarding balance of caring for a diverse primary care population while contributing to a practice culture built on teamwork, respect, and professional growth. Located in Woodbridge, VA, in the heart of Prince William County, this position is ideal for an experienced APP who values autonomy, strong physician collaboration, work-life balance, and the opportunity to make a meaningful impact in a growing community.

Position Highlights:

  • Flexibility within a Monday-Friday, 8am-5pm

  • 40 hours a week (36 patient contact hours and 4 hours of admin time)

  • Average 25 patients/day

  • Small, growing practice where team members truly support one another

  • No call, no weekends – office is closed Saturday and Sunday

Benefit Highlights:

  • Comprehensive Benefits & Retirement Package

  • Up to $14,400 Annual QPI Bonus

  • $3,000 Annual CME Allowance

  • $10,000 Student Loan Reimbursement Program

  • Malpractice and Tail coverage

  • Fully integrated EHR (Epic) & Team utilizes DAX Copilot AI for patient transcription

  • https://www.sentara.com/aboutus/news/articles/new-advanced-practice-provider-onboarding-program

Minimum Requirements:

  • Active NP or PA 

  • Minimum master’s degree required

  • Minimum 3 years’ experience working as a Internal Medicine APP
